How much funding has ScoreStream raised?

ScoreStream has raised a total of $5.6M across 4 funding rounds:

2014

Debt

$800K

2015

Angel/Seed

$3M

2016

Private Equity

$1.8M

2021

Debt

$80K

Debt (2014): $800K, investors not publicly disclosed

Angel/Seed (2015): $3M led by Sinclair Digital Ventures

Private Equity (2016): $1.8M, investors not publicly disclosed

Debt (2021): $80K featuring PPP

Key Investors in ScoreStream

Sinclair Digital Ventures

Sinclair Digital Ventures is the investment arm of Sinclair Broadcast Group, focusing on the intersection of digital technology and content distribution to drive high-value commercial partnerships.
